Cmb.Tech N.V. (CMBT) Industrial Operations Profile
Cmb.Tech N.V., formerly Euronav NV, is a marine transportation company transitioning towards sustainable energy solutions. With a diverse fleet and a focus on green hydrogen and ammonia fuels, Cmb.Tech operates in the Marine, H2 Infra, and H2 Industry sectors, positioning itself for future growth in the evolving maritime landscape.

What Does CMBT Do?
Cmb.Tech N.V., headquartered in Antwerp, Belgium, has evolved from its roots as Euronav NV, a traditional marine transportation company, into a multifaceted organization focused on both conventional shipping and sustainable energy solutions. Founded in 2003, the company operates through three key divisions: Marine, H2 Infra, and H2 Industry. The Marine division manages a diverse fleet of 88 conventional fuel vessels and 64 vessels, including crude oil tankers, bulk carriers, container ships, chemical tankers, offshore wind supply vessels, tugboats, and ferries. This division forms the bedrock of Cmb.Tech's operations, providing essential transportation services across global trade routes. The H2 Infra division is dedicated to developing and securing green molecule supplies, focusing on the production and distribution of green hydrogen and ammonia fuels. This division aims to establish a robust infrastructure to support the adoption of sustainable fuels in the maritime industry and beyond. The H2 Industry division focuses on providing scalable dual-fuel industrial applications, enabling industries to transition to cleaner energy sources while maintaining operational efficiency. Cmb.Tech's strategic shift towards hydrogen and ammonia fuels reflects a commitment to reducing carbon emissions and promoting environmental sustainability within the marine transportation sector. As a subsidiary of CMB NV, Cmb.Tech leverages its parent company's resources and expertise to drive innovation and growth in the sustainable energy space.

Cmb.Tech N.V. Financial Trajectory
Cmb.Tech N.V. (CMBT) reported $691.4M in revenue for Q2 FY2026, reflecting 33.1% growth compared to the prior quarter. The company recorded net income of $357.9M, with diluted EPS of $1.23. Quarter-over-quarter revenue has been mixed, typical for a mid-cap company operating in Industrials. Across the four most recent quarters, CMBT averaged $0.72 in diluted EPS.

Recent Quarterly Results
| Quarter | Revenue | Net Income | EPS |
|---|---|---|---|
| Q2 FY2026 | $691M | $358M | $1.23 |
| Q1 FY2026 | $520M | $369M | $1.27 |
| Q4 FY2025 | $589M | $89M | $0.31 |
| Q3 FY2025 | $454M | $20M | $0.08 |

Cmb.Tech N.V. ADR Information
An American Depositary Receipt (ADR) is a certificate representing shares of a foreign company trading on U.S. stock exchanges. CMBT, as an ADR, allows U.S. investors to invest in Cmb.Tech N.V. without the complexities of cross-border transactions. The ADR is denominated in U.S. dollars, simplifying trading and reporting for U.S. investors.
